Installing exterior double prehung doors in a stucco house is not a complicated job. Prehung doors are hinged and mounted in a jamb by the manufacturer, which eliminates the need to plane or mortise the doors. In addition, sets for stucco walls include a stucco "ground," or ground molding, and threshold as part of the prehung unit.. Porsche financing

Plumb the hinge side with 1x6 pressure treated wood, then hang the door. for the latch side, slip in a 1x, or shim it depending on your spacing ...The frame around the prehung door is typically a thickness of ¾” on both sides, resulting in a total additional width of 1 ½”. In theory, that means your opening should be one and one-half inch wider than the door. Not only does it provide security and pro...The national average materials cost to install a prehung door is $121.46 per door, with a range between $96.11 to $146.81. The total price for labor and materials per door is $390.96, coming in between $307.63 to $474.30. Set the sill pan in the rough opening, aligning the front edge (for continuous slab) or folded down edge (for step down) with the exterior of the rough opening. Mark a line across the front and back of the sill pan. Apply three 3/8" beads of sealant between the lines.Cutting the frame. Cut the same amount from the bottom of the frame as you cut from the door. Because exteriordoor frames are rabbeted, in addition to shortening the jamb legs, you need to recut the rabbets for the sill. Cut the fasteners holding the jambs to the sill with an oscillating multitool.
